A Career Advancement Programme in Enzyme Inactivation Mechanisms offers specialized training in understanding and manipulating enzyme activity. The program delves into various inactivation techniques, including chemical modification, thermal denaturation, and proteolytic degradation, equipping participants with advanced knowledge of enzyme kinetics and protein structure-function relationships.
Learning outcomes typically include a comprehensive understanding of enzyme mechanisms, proficiency in various inactivation methods, and the ability to design and implement inactivation strategies for specific applications. Participants gain practical experience through laboratory work, data analysis, and project-based learning, fostering critical thinking and problem-solving skills relevant to industrial settings.
The duration of such a programme can vary, ranging from several weeks for intensive short courses to several months or even years for more comprehensive master's level programs. The specific timeframe depends on the depth of coverage and the level of practical training incorporated.
Industry relevance is high, particularly in biotechnology, pharmaceuticals, food processing, and environmental remediation. Expertise in enzyme inactivation is crucial for various applications, including the development of enzyme-based therapeutics, the stabilization of enzymes in industrial processes, and the control of enzyme activity in various environmental contexts.
